Core Insights - Circle's primary revenue sources are reserve income from holding cash-equivalent assets and monetizing transaction processes and network infrastructure, with the latter expected to grow significantly as network adoption increases [4][33]. - The company plans to launch Arc, a proprietary blockchain designed for stablecoin financial applications, which will use USDC as the native asset for transaction fees [3][7][27]. - Circle's competitive advantage lies in its scalable model and inherent operational leverage, supported by a strong liquidity infrastructure and significant network effects in the stablecoin market [6][25][31]. Financial Performance - Circle reported a 53% year-over-year increase in total revenue and reserve income, reaching $658 million, driven by a substantial rise in USDC circulation [3][34]. - The company experienced a 5.4-fold increase in USDC on-chain transaction volume, indicating robust growth in its stablecoin network [34]. - Other revenue sources grew to $24 million, primarily from subscription and service income related to blockchain partnerships, reflecting a 3.5-fold increase [35]. Market Position and Strategy - The stablecoin market is characterized as a "winner-takes-all" environment, with Circle benefiting from deep liquidity infrastructure and a strong competitive moat [6][25]. - The passage of the GENIUS Act is seen as a catalyst for mainstream financial institutions to accelerate the adoption of stablecoin technology [10][25]. - Circle's cautious acquisition strategy focuses on organic growth and small strategic acquisitions rather than large, complex mergers [12][13][56]. Product Development and Partnerships - The upcoming Arc blockchain aims to support various financial applications, including payments and capital markets, and will provide a low-cost, predictable fee structure [27][28]. - Circle has expanded partnerships with major financial institutions and payment providers, enhancing USDC's utility and integration into various payment networks [11][30]. - The company is actively developing its Circle Payment Network (CPN) to facilitate international fund transfers and other payment types, with significant interest from financial institutions [26][49]. Future Outlook - Circle anticipates a compound annual growth rate of 40% for USDC over the coming years, with other revenue expected to range between $75 million and $85 million in 2025 [36]. - The company is focused on expanding its platform capabilities and partnerships to drive long-term growth and profitability [36].

Circle(CRCL) - 2025 Q2 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-08-12 13:00
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- USDC in circulation grew to $61.3 billion at June 30, representing a 90% year-over-year increase, and reached $65.2 billion by August 10, marking a 6.4% increase since quarter-end [7][28] - Total revenue and reserve income increased by 53% year-over-year to $658 million in Q2, while total distribution transaction and other costs rose by 64% year-over-year to $407 million [28][29] - Adjusted EBITDA was $126 million in the quarter, up 52% year-over-year, resulting in a 50% adjusted EBITDA margin [30]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- USDC on-chain transaction volume grew 5.4 times year-over-year to nearly $6 trillion, with $2.4 trillion in transactions recorded in July alone [7][27] - CCTP volume also showed significant growth, up 4.1 times year-over-year, indicating the importance of blockchain interoperability [27] - Other revenue increased to $24 million in Q2, up 3.5 times year-over-year, primarily driven by a $13 million increase in subscription and services revenue [29]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The total addressable market for stablecoins is considered massive, with dollar stablecoins representing only 1% of the U.S. M2 money supply [9] - The company operates the largest regulated stablecoin network globally, with significant growth driven by partnerships with major financial institutions and technology companies [11][22]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company aims to build the largest stablecoin network, leveraging its platform to support developers, enterprises, and institutions [24] - The launch of the Circle Payments Network (CPN) is a key initiative to transform international money movement, with active payment corridors already established in several countries [13][58] - The introduction of ARC, a new Layer 1 blockchain, is designed to support stablecoin finance and enhance transaction efficiency [15][93]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management highlighted the rapid expansion of commercial opportunities post-IPO and the positive impact of the Genius Act on stablecoin adoption [12][99] - The company anticipates a conservative multi-year growth rate of 40% CAGR for USDC, reflecting the increasing demand for stablecoins across various sectors [31][108] - Management emphasized the importance of building strong partnerships and the need for financial institutions to integrate new technologies, which may take time [100] Other Important Information - The company has committed to corporate impact by reserving shares for future donations to its foundation [9] - The regulatory environment is seen as a significant tailwind for the company's growth, particularly with the passage of the Genius Act [12][100] Q&A Session Summary Question: Thoughts on ARC and its revenue model - Management expressed excitement about ARC and its potential to underpin stablecoin finance, with gas fees in USDC expected to become a revenue source [35][39] Question: Details on USYC and partnership with Binance - The expanded partnership with Binance includes deeper integration of Circle's wallet technology and aims to promote USDC and USYC as yield-bearing collateral [40][44] Question: Understanding transaction volume versus circulation - Management explained that the high velocity of USDC transactions reflects improvements in blockchain technology and growing payment utility [50][53] Question: Milestones for CPN and its relationship with ARC - The focus is on activating more payment corridors and developing self-service tools for institutions to integrate with CPN [58][60] Question: Payment networks and competition - Management views USDC as a market-neutral infrastructure that supports various payment networks, emphasizing the importance of growing utility and distribution [64][66] Question: Adoption of USDC in remittance - The company is seeing increasing demand for USDC in remittance, with partnerships expanding in both consumer and B2B segments [78][80] Question: Partnership with OKX - The partnership with OKX aims to enhance liquidity and promote USDC to a large user base, contributing to the growth of the network [82][86] Question: Distribution and gas fees for ARC - Management discussed the goal of having a distributed network of professional validators for ARC, ensuring low and predictable transaction costs [90][92] Question: Impact of the Genius Act on growth - Management noted a significant increase in institutional interest post-Genius Act, which is expected to drive further adoption of USDC [95][100]

复星国际回应申请稳定币牌照:不予置评
Xin Lang Cai Jing· 2025-08-12 08:28
Core Viewpoint - Fosun International has confirmed its application for a stablecoin license in Hong Kong and has assembled a dedicated team for this purpose [1] Group 1: Company Actions - Fosun International's Chairman, Guo Guangchang, personally led a team to meet with Hong Kong's Chief Executive, John Lee, and Financial Secretary, Paul Chan, on August 6 [1] - The company has not provided any comments regarding the stablecoin license application when approached by media [1] Group 2: Market Context - The news comes in the wake of the implementation of Hong Kong's Stablecoin Regulation on August 1, which has prompted major internet companies like JD.com and Ant Group to accelerate their stablecoin market strategies [1] - Following the announcement, Fosun International's stock price surged over 20% at one point, closing at HKD 6.05 per share, reflecting a 13.30% increase [1]
